Java与MySQL数据库连接实战指南

java怎么连接mysql数据库

时间:2025-08-27 08:48

在Java应用程序中连接MySQL数据库是开发中的常见需求。下面将详细介绍完整的连接步骤和注意事项。

1. 准备工作

首先需要下载MySQL Connector/J驱动,这是官方提供的JDBC驱动程序。可以通过Maven添加依赖:


mysql
mysql-connector-java
8.0.33

2. 建立数据库连接

使用DriverManager获取连接的基本代码示例:

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;

public class MySQLConnector {
    public static void main(String【】 args) {
        String url = "jdbc:mysql://localhost:3306/your_database";
        String user = "username";
        String password = "password";

        try (Connection conn = DriverManager.getConnection(url, user, password)) {
            System.out.println("数据库连接成功!");
        } catch (SQLException e) {
            System.out.println("连接失败:" + e.getMessage());
        }
    }
}

3. 重要注意事项

  • 确保MySQL服务正在运行
  • 使用try-with-resources确保连接正确关闭
  • 生产环境中建议使用连接池(如HikariCP)
  • 注意处理SQLException异常
  • 新版本MySQL驱动推荐使用"com.mysql.cj.jdbc.Driver"

4. 连接参数配置

可以在连接URL中添加额外参数:

jdbc:mysql://localhost:3306/dbname?useSSL=false&serverTimezone=UTC

通过以上步骤,你就可以成功在Java项目中连接MySQL数据库了。记得在实际项目中妥善处理敏感信息,如数据库密码等。

内网穿透工具自托管 vs 云端中转:穿云箭和花生壳优缺点深度分析
内网ip远程控制,借助内网IP实现远程控制的完整指南
远程访问内网IP:打破网络边界的连接艺术
理解Windows系统中的NAT转发功能
内网穿透工具自托管 vs 云端中转:穿云箭和花生壳优缺点分析
手把手配置SSR端口转发:UDP协议支持与高级设置详解
什么是nat123?nat123的核心功能
nat123端口映射:轻松实现外网访问内网
nat123下载:轻松获取内网穿透工具
nat123官网:老牌内网穿透工具